Derivative Formulas of Trigonometric Functions

The differentiation formulas of the six trigonometric functions are listed below:

  • sin x = cos x
  • cos x = -sin x
  • tan x = sec2 x
  • csc x = -cot x csc x
  • sec x = sec x tan x
  • cot x = -csc2 x

Finding the Derivative of a Trigonometric Function

Finding the derivative of a trigonometric function involves the use of limits. Suppose the derivative of sin x can be calculated as given below:

Let f(x) = sin x

Then, the derivative of f(x) can be found as follows:

f'(x) = limh->0 [f(x + h) - f(x)]/h

Using the limit definition of the derivative, we can find the derivatives of the other trigonometric functions.
